My name is Tim Kennedy. My practice is focused on counseling entrepreneurs, start-ups, and established businesses on all legal and business related matters.
I received a Bachelor of Science in Commerce, emphasis in Finance, from Santa Clara University in 1996 and a law degree from Santa Clara University’s School of Law in 2008. In between, I spent nearly ten years working first as a Corporate Financial Analyst for a financial asset management firm in the Bay Area, then as a Financial Analyst and Business and Systems Analyst for a hardware engineering start up. I gained a unique, behind-the-scenes perspective on how to manage both large and small companies. Whether it is debits and credits, business and marketing plans, CRM systems, or sales forecasting and revenue recognition, I understand the concept and speak the language.
